Team principal Vasseur departs Renault

Renault have announced that Frederic Vasseur is leaving his role as team principal with immediate effect.
After a first season spent relaunching and rebuilding its works F1 squad, Renault and Vasseur have agreed by mutual consent to part company as of today.
According to Renault, “both parties remain committed to maintaining the good working relationship they have enjoyed and expect this to take a new form sometime in the future.”
The team will provide full details of plans for their 2017 season when they present their new car next month on February 21.
In the meantime, the team will continue to be managed by Jerome Stoll, its President, and Cyril Abiteboul, its Managing Director.
